π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έ The USA has just released the new Dietary Guidelines for Americans (2025–2030) on January 7, 2026, highlighting the importance of nutrient-dense foods that fit into realistic, everyday eating patterns.

This is where eggs stand out.

Eggs deliver multiple essential nutrients in a simple, affordable, and versatile food, making them easy to integrate into daily meals.

🍳 A simple, nutritious dish from the kitchen: Scrambled eggs with tomatoes.

Tomatoes are rich in lycopene, an antioxidant known to support cell protection and overall health. When tomatoes are cooked and combined with eggs, lycopene becomes more bioavailable, meaning the body can absorb it more efficiently.

πŸ₯— Why this combination works:

β€’ Natural egg fats help improve lycopene absorption
β€’ High-quality protein supports a balanced, satisfying meal Sometimes, it’s not just what we eat, but how foods work together.
